Jet Aviation signs new completion agreement for a BBJ3
Jet Aviation has signed a new aircraft completions agreement with an undisclosed client. The agreement, for a new BBJ3, is scheduled to start work in the third quarter of 2012. Studio E/motions are the contracted creators of the aircraft interior design for the undisclosed client. Airbus sets new records for its Corporate Jet Business
Airbus delivered 15 corporate jets in 2010, worth more than US$ 1.5 billion at list prices and in doing so set a new record for its corporate jet business. The orders comprised of 13 A318 Elites, Airbus Corporate Jetliners (ACJs) and A320 Prestige’s, plus two VIP widebody A330/A340s.
